James Shaw Signs for Ribble Weldtite

Ribble Weldtite are delighted to announce the addition of James Shaw to their rider roster for the 2021 season. James joins the team from Danish Pro-Continental Team Riwal Securitas. The team are looking forward to James sharing his experience, climbing strength and all round versatility with the rest of the riders.

James will be a familiar name to many on the British scene, having previously tasted success at a domestic level, with wins in Elite Road Series events, the Ryedale GP and The Tour of the Reservoir in 2019. James was also 5th on GC in the Tour de Yorkshire that year. Despite the challenges presented this season, James has still amassed a number of quality races days, including representing Great Britain at the World Championships in Imola.

James “I’m incredibly grateful for the last minute opportunity from the team. I fully intend on making the most of it in 2020. I know a lot of the team at Ribble Weldtite and with their support I’m looking forward to getting out there and winning bike races again to help me return to the top of the sport.”

Tom Timothy, Ribble Weldtite Team Principal added, “We are really pleased to add James to our line up for 2021 and we feel with James we have a squad that can challenge at any level. James has an aptitude for arduous single day and multi day events and we will be looking to shape a calendar to enable him to showcase his talents in these events.

Alongside seeking to balance his racing opportunities throughout the season ensuring he competes at a UCI level and the domestic scene. We want to give all our riders the opportunity to gain the attention of WorldTour and Pro Continental teams and this is a key focus for James as well.”

Despite a challenging 2020 for obvious reasons, the team continues to go from strength to strength, with a clear vision and the commitment and support of a core group of partners. 2021 is shaping up to be the team’s most successful to date, both on and off the bike.
